SXA-389
RF Micro Devices Inc
Wide Band Medium Power Amplifier, 400MHz Min, 2500MHz Max, 1 Func, BIPolar, PLASTIC, SOT-89, 4 PIN
|
Pbfree Code | No | |
Rohs Code | No | |
Part Life Cycle Code | Transferred | |
Ihs Manufacturer | SIRENZA MICRODEVICES INC | |
Package Description | TO-243 | |
Reach Compliance Code | unknown | |
Additional Feature | HIGH RELIABILITY | |
Characteristic Impedance | 50 Ω | |
Construction | COMPONENT | |
Gain | 12.5 dB | |
Input Power-Max (CW) | 20 dBm | |
JESD-609 Code | e0 | |
Mounting Feature | SURFACE MOUNT | |
Number of Functions | 1 | |
Number of Terminals | 3 | |
Operating Frequency-Max | 2500 MHz | |
Operating Frequency-Min | 400 MHz | |
Operating Temperature-Max | 85 °C | |
Operating Temperature-Min | -40 °C | |
Package Body Material | PLASTIC/EPOXY | |
Package Equivalence Code | TO-243 | |
Power Supplies | 5 V | |
RF/Microwave Device Type | WIDE BAND MEDIUM POWER | |
Surface Mount | YES | |
Technology | BIPOLAR | |
Terminal Finish | Tin/Lead (Sn/Pb) | |
VSWR-Max | 1.4 |
